Transaction 104a214bedebdcb7677382ac915aa12f07bdf129cf30d849c08bbe5caaf3e5f0

1 Input
2 Outputs
  • 104a214bedebdcb7677382ac915aa12f07bdf129cf30d849c08bbe5caaf3e5f0:0
  • value  758297720
    address  16bzuCC66ibLvcE3qsrM7CqrPTZbJpB5xp
  • 104a214bedebdcb7677382ac915aa12f07bdf129cf30d849c08bbe5caaf3e5f0:1
  • value  303702
    address  16RcMio7WqNCDk7nghfkRBSawDWTqenR6G